summaryrefslogtreecommitdiffstats
path: root/src/core/hle/service/nfc/nfc_result.h
diff options
context:
space:
mode:
authorbunnei <bunneidev@gmail.com>2023-05-07 21:18:09 +0200
committerGitHub <noreply@github.com>2023-05-07 21:18:09 +0200
commite58090c9c731701662d0824c2fd081467f21f5c3 (patch)
treef35c9a080f3b5a9067381b615eca928e8825ee20 /src/core/hle/service/nfc/nfc_result.h
parentMerge pull request #10192 from bunnei/update-dynarmic-2 (diff)
parentservice: nfc: Merge device interfaces and create the device manager (diff)
downloadyuzu-e58090c9c731701662d0824c2fd081467f21f5c3.tar
yuzu-e58090c9c731701662d0824c2fd081467f21f5c3.tar.gz
yuzu-e58090c9c731701662d0824c2fd081467f21f5c3.tar.bz2
yuzu-e58090c9c731701662d0824c2fd081467f21f5c3.tar.lz
yuzu-e58090c9c731701662d0824c2fd081467f21f5c3.tar.xz
yuzu-e58090c9c731701662d0824c2fd081467f21f5c3.tar.zst
yuzu-e58090c9c731701662d0824c2fd081467f21f5c3.zip
Diffstat (limited to 'src/core/hle/service/nfc/nfc_result.h')
-rw-r--r--src/core/hle/service/nfc/nfc_result.h33
1 files changed, 19 insertions, 14 deletions
diff --git a/src/core/hle/service/nfc/nfc_result.h b/src/core/hle/service/nfc/nfc_result.h
index 146b8ba61..917d79ef8 100644
--- a/src/core/hle/service/nfc/nfc_result.h
+++ b/src/core/hle/service/nfc/nfc_result.h
@@ -1,5 +1,5 @@
-// SPDX-FileCopyrightText: Copyright 2022 yuzu Emulator Project
-// SPDX-License-Identifier: GPL-2.0-or-later
+// SPDX-FileCopyrightText: Copyright 2023 yuzu Emulator Project
+// SPDX-License-Identifier: GPL-3.0-or-later
#pragma once
@@ -7,17 +7,22 @@
namespace Service::NFC {
-constexpr Result DeviceNotFound(ErrorModule::NFC, 64);
-constexpr Result InvalidArgument(ErrorModule::NFC, 65);
-constexpr Result WrongDeviceState(ErrorModule::NFC, 73);
-constexpr Result NfcDisabled(ErrorModule::NFC, 80);
-constexpr Result TagRemoved(ErrorModule::NFC, 97);
-
-constexpr Result MifareDeviceNotFound(ErrorModule::NFCMifare, 64);
-constexpr Result MifareInvalidArgument(ErrorModule::NFCMifare, 65);
-constexpr Result MifareWrongDeviceState(ErrorModule::NFCMifare, 73);
-constexpr Result MifareNfcDisabled(ErrorModule::NFCMifare, 80);
-constexpr Result MifareTagRemoved(ErrorModule::NFCMifare, 97);
-constexpr Result MifareReadError(ErrorModule::NFCMifare, 288);
+constexpr Result ResultDeviceNotFound(ErrorModule::NFC, 64);
+constexpr Result ResultInvalidArgument(ErrorModule::NFC, 65);
+constexpr Result ResultWrongApplicationAreaSize(ErrorModule::NFP, 68);
+constexpr Result ResultWrongDeviceState(ErrorModule::NFC, 73);
+constexpr Result ResultUnknown74(ErrorModule::NFC, 74);
+constexpr Result ResultUnknown76(ErrorModule::NFC, 76);
+constexpr Result ResultNfcNotInitialized(ErrorModule::NFC, 77);
+constexpr Result ResultNfcDisabled(ErrorModule::NFC, 80);
+constexpr Result ResultWriteAmiiboFailed(ErrorModule::NFP, 88);
+constexpr Result ResultTagRemoved(ErrorModule::NFC, 97);
+constexpr Result ResultRegistrationIsNotInitialized(ErrorModule::NFP, 120);
+constexpr Result ResultApplicationAreaIsNotInitialized(ErrorModule::NFP, 128);
+constexpr Result ResultCorruptedData(ErrorModule::NFP, 144);
+constexpr Result ResultWrongApplicationAreaId(ErrorModule::NFP, 152);
+constexpr Result ResultApplicationAreaExist(ErrorModule::NFP, 168);
+constexpr Result ResultNotAnAmiibo(ErrorModule::NFP, 178);
+constexpr Result ResultUnknown216(ErrorModule::NFC, 216);
} // namespace Service::NFC